Diagnosis Test small and ovoid in the early stage, later fusiform, up to 3 mm in length, planispirally coiled throughout, about six or seven whorls, septa flat, slightly curved forward, plane or only slightly fluted; chomata large and asymmetrical. U. Carboniferous (L. Moscovian); Laos. (Loeblich & Tappan, 1987, Foraminiferal Genera and Their Classification) [details]
